Along with the start of spring, coinciding with a plethora of outdoor activities and sports, the month of March also celebrates Developmental Disability Awareness Month. Developmental disabilities pose various physical, emotional, social, and cognitive challenges, and affect an estimated 10 million children in the U.S.
While developmental disabilities often inhibit a child’s health-related quality of life, organized youth sports can play a big role in improving it. SportsPlus, an organization located in Montgomery County, Maryland, provides sports programs for children with disabilities based on a positive, encouraging environment, and fosters a sense of belonging as well as social experiences with peers. All too often kids with disabilities are reminded of their weaknesses, so this kind of organized activity helps them achieve many goals with confidence.
